Product Description
- The SMC CDLQ compact cylinder is used to reliably hold workpieces or drive elements in the extended position.
- It is used in assembly and clamping systems where controlled holding of the end position is required.
- This design enhances process reliability during vertical movements.
- The SMC CDLQ double-acting compact cylinder with magnetic ring features a locking unit that locks the piston rod in place during retraction.
- The through-bore allows for easy integration into machine structures and enables direct mounting without additional brackets.
- The robust aluminium housing ensures precise and long-lasting operation.
- Material of cylinder tube, housing of locking unit, sleeve (Ø 32 mm) – aluminium, hard anodised
- Material of piston, sleeve (from Ø 40 mm) – aluminium, chromated
- Piston rod material – steel, hard chrome-plated
- Damping disc material – polyurethane
- Material of scrapers, seals – NBR
- Operating principle – double-acting
- Medium - Compressed air
- Mounting type - Through-hole
- Test pressure - 15 bar
- Max. operating pressure – 10 bar
- Min. operating pressure - 2 bar
- Ambient and medium temperature – Without signal transmitter: -10 to 70 °C (not frozen) / With signal transmitter: -10 to 60 °C (not frozen)
- Grease - Not required (lubricated for life)
- Piston speed – 50 to 500 mm/s
- Clamping type – Spring-loaded clamps
- Release pressure – min. 2 bar
- Clamping pressure – max. 0.5 bar
- Clamping direction – in the direction of travel
- Connection size - G 1/8" (Ø 32 and 40 mm) / G 1/4" (Ø 50 and 63 mm)
- Connection size for releasing the clamp - M5 x 0.8
- Holding force (max. static load) – 403 to 1559 N
- Piston diameter – 32 to 63 mm
- Stroke – 15 to 100 mm
- Width – 61.7 to 93 mm
- Height – 45 to 77 mm
- Length – 82 to 192 mm
- Weight – 471 to 2246 g
